Commercial Description:
Belgian Ales represent the height of the brewers' art. Sophisticated brewing techniques, yeast blends and unique flavoring elements have elevated the beers of Belgium to the status enjoyed by wine in other countries. PranQster follows in this tradition using a mixed culture of antique yeast strains that results in a floral nose, a full fruity flavor and a clean finish.

Pours a pale golden with a two finger frothy white head. Explosively carbonated. The nose is sweet, grassy, light Belgian funk, fruity. The flavor is sharp and spicy, some citrus, Belgian shows through, warm alcohol. Very carbonated crisp mouthfeel. Finishes grassy and sweet. The flavor is much better than the nose.

Golden color and a fluffy white head with moderate persistence. Nose of fruit, floral, and sawdust (the sawdust part brought the aroma score down by at least a point). Fruity taste with some woody notes and some distinct tartness. Short lasting tart finish. This beer has all the taste and aroma components of golden Belgian ales but it doesn’t have as good a balance as the better Belgians. Pretty good effort, but no where near as good as many golden ales that are actually from Belgium.
